Guardian is seeking individuals with Group Disability claims experience to join our dynamic Appeals Team. The Appeals Case Manager II (ACM 2) is responsible for adjudicating assigned appeals for Group Life and Disability claims. The ACM 2 provides a full and fair reconsideration review, as required under the Employee Retirement Income Security Act (ERISA), by thoroughly assessing the claim file and applying plan provisions in accordance with applicable state and federal regulations.

This role supports Group Short-Term Disability, Long-Term Disability and Life Waiver of Premium appeals.

You will

  • Utilize effective claim management skills to plan, implement, and execute the investigation of disputed claims; ensure timely and compliant appeal resolution

  • Identify and interpret relevant plan language and thoroughly investigate all claim issues to make an accurate and non-biased appeal determination

  • Evaluate medical, financial, and other claim information in consultation with clinical/vocational professionals for the purpose of resolving disputes.

  • Utilize proactive outreach to provide superior customer service to all internal and external customers

  • Identify legal and/or compliance scenarios that require additional research; facilitate resolution

  • Maintain current knowledge of all ERISA and Department of Labor guidelines.

  • Independently prioritize workload based on individual and departmental deadlines

  • Readily share insights and learnings with claims colleagues

What started in the heart of New York City at Delmonico's restaurant in 1860, the Guardian Life Insurance Company of America has grown from a modest meeting of 21 German-American entrepreneurs into one of the largest mutual insurance companies in the United States. With a founding vision guided by principles of mutual assistance and strong financial integrity, Guardian is dedicated to protecting families, individuals, and businesses across the nation.

Over its long history, Guardian has shown resilience and adaptability, evolving from the Germania Life Insurance Company of America to its present name in 1918, and becoming a wholly-owned mutual company by 1925. Through significant milestones such as entering the employee benefits market in 1957 and merging with Berkshire Life Insurance in 2001, Guardian has broadened its scope. Today, the company provides a wide range of essential services including life insurance, disability insurance, dental plans, and financial investment products. With over 7,700 employees and a network of financial professionals, Guardian stands at the forefront of the insurance industry, serving millions of policyholders while maintaining a strong commitment to community service and financial integrity.
